Creative Ways to Incorporate Coloring Pages into Your Wedding
Once you've found the perfect coloring pages, it's time to get creative with how you'll incorporate them into your wedding. Here are some inspiring ideas:

Wedding Stationery
Use coloring pages as part of your save-the-date, invitation suite, or even on your wedding program. Guests can color them in while waiting for the ceremony to begin or during downtime at the reception.

















Table Decor
Set out coloring pages and colored pencils at each table as a fun activity for guests. You can also use them as part of your table settings, such as place cards or table numbers.
Photo Booth Props
Create a DIY photo booth with coloring pages as props. Guests can hold up their colored-in pages for a unique and memorable photo opportunity.
Favors and Party Favs
Package coloring pages with colored pencils or crayons as wedding favors or party favors. This thoughtful gift encourages creativity and provides a fun activity for guests to enjoy long after your wedding day.
Tips for Using Free Coloring Pages in Your Wedding
To ensure a smooth and successful integration of coloring pages into your wedding, consider these helpful tips:
- Test print: Always test print a coloring page to ensure it prints well on your chosen paper and that the colors look as expected.
- Consider paper weight: Opt for heavier paper stock to prevent bleed-through and ensure a better coloring experience for your guests.
- Provide supplies: Make sure to have enough colored pencils, crayons, or markers on hand for guests to use.
- Display and organize: Set out coloring pages in an organized and appealing manner, using frames, clipboards, or easels to keep them visible and accessible.
